CSIC NM008- Mortar with biocide properties.
Development of a repair mortar with biocide properties, using for historic-artistic building restoration.
Specification sheet:
DESCRIPTION
When mortars are exposed to atmospheres with high humidity one of the main causes of their decay is the growth and development of microorganisms. Conventional mortars should, therefore, be replaced by others with such properties, which do not change the base material properties and must prevent the damage to be supported by the growth of microorganisms.
For this reason, a mortar with biocides properties, protected by patent, is developed. They have the physics, mechanics and mechanic-resistant properties of base material, besides biocides properties. In the same way, the addition of the clay with biocide doesn’t change the external appearance of the mortar, that is important in restoration buildings, mainly at Historic-Artistic Heritage buildings. Also, this mortar have been proved in atmospheres at high contaminant gases levels such as SO2 and NOx. These biocides properties are comming from the addition of a biocide including into a clay mineral (sepiolite) that has a high absorption/adsorption capacity with constancy of volume. So this mortar will keep their structure and properties even in constructions in contact with water.
The mortars described in the patent include a clay-like mineral which supports a biocide, in proportions that do not substantially modify the other properties of the mortars, but which prevent the growth and development of fungi, algae, lichens, etc. For this reason the clay mineral has to be included into the mortar between 2 or 10% of its proportion.
The biocide could be every chemical product which contain this biocide property, and because of its size and molecular struture can keep it into the clay support.
These mortars are used to repair ancient mosaics, which is necessary to resolve the biodeterioration problem (lime mortar), and in the civil construction where people can’t be in touch with them and the water or humit (cement mortars) are presented in it, where these conditions helps the growth of microorganism.
COMPETITIVE ADVANTAGES
A conventional mortar with unmodified physical, mechanical and resistant properties which is resistant to microbial decay.
